Puedes enfrentarte al error VCRUNTIME140.dll falta al ejecutar algunos programas y juegos modernos. El problema está relacionado con el hecho de que la biblioteca del sistema vcruntime140.dll ha desaparecido, está dañada, no está registrada o utiliza la versión antigua en el ordenador. Este error puede aparecer tanto en Windows 10 como en Windows 7/8.1. En este artículo hablaremos de cómo corregir el siguiente error cuando se ejecutan aplicaciones recién instaladas:
Error de sistema
El programa no puede iniciarse porque VCRUNTIME140.dll no está en su ordenador. Intenta reinstalar el programa para solucionar este problema.

En primer lugar, entendamos para qué se usa el archivo de la biblioteca vcruntime140.dll. Este archivo es parte del paquete del sistema Microsoft Visual C++ Redistributable Package, que incluye componentes del entorno Visual C ++ para ejecutar aplicaciones escritas en los lenguajes de programación C++ y C#. Este archivo debe estar en su computadora si desea ejecutar un programa o juego desarrollado en Microsoft Visual C++. Los desarrolladores de software a veces pueden incluir los componentes del entorno del Paquete redistribuible de Visual C++ (incluido el archivo vcruntime140.dll) en sus distribuciones, pero no siempre es así. Por consiguiente, para resolver el problema, pueden:
- Descargue e instale la última versión del paquete redistribuible de Microsoft Visual C++ desde el sitio web de Microsoft;
- Reinstalar un programa o juego;
- Intenta encontrar el archivo vcruntime140.dll en tu ordenador y regístralo de nuevo.
LEER TAMBIÉN Cómo configurar la Replicación DFS en Windows Server 2016?
¡Importante! Te advierto que no debes descargar el archivo vcruntime140.dll de sitios de terceros, porque es inútil (lo más probable es que estés descargando una versión antigua del archivo) y peligroso (puedes descargar un archivo con un troyano o un virus incorporado).
La forma más fácil y correcta es descargar la última versión de Microsoft Visual C ++ 2015 de la página web de Microsoft. Sin embargo, antes que nada necesitas determinar qué versión de Windows se usa en tu computadora: x86 o x64.
- Presiona la combinación de teclas Win+Pause ;
-
En la ventana Sistema , anote el valor en la cadena Tipo de sistema . En mi caso es Sistema operativo de 64 bits, procesador basado en x64 ;

- Esto significa que necesito descargar Microsoft Visual C ++ 2015 x64.
Ir a la página oficial de Microsoft con el siguiente link . Se le pedirá que descargue Microsoft Visual C ++ 2015 Redistributable Update 3 RC. Haga clic en el botón Descargar .

Selecciona el bitness del paquete que quieres descargar. En nuestro caso, este es vc_redist.x64.exe y haz clic en Next .

Guarda el archivo en un disco local y ejecútalo como administrador.

En el asistente de instalación, marca la casilla » Acepto los términos y condiciones de la licencia » y haz clic en el botón Siguiente .

Espere hasta que la instalación de VC Redistributable esté completa, luego reinicie el ordenador y compruebe que el programa que no se inició debido a la falta del archivo vcruntime140.dll ahora se inicia correctamente.
LEER TAMBIÉN Esta aplicación no puede abrirse mientras la UAC esté apagada
Si no puede descargar el archivo vc_redist.x64.exe, puede intentar encontrar el archivo vcruntime140.dll en su ordenador mediante una búsqueda (el propio archivo vcruntime140.dll puede estar ubicado en el directorio de instalación de varios programas instalados en su ordenador, por ejemplo, Firefox, OneDrive, Skype, Microsoft Office 365). Cópialo en la carpeta C:WindowsSystem32 o C:WindowsSysWOW64 (dependiendo de la bitácora de Windows).

Intente simplemente volver a registrar la biblioteca en el sistema utilizando el siguiente comando (debe realizarse utilizando el símbolo del sistema con privilegios de administrador:
regsvr32 vcruntime140.dll